What Makes a Robot Vacuum the Best?
When considering a robot vacuum, a number of elements enter play:
- Suction Power: The efficiency of a robot vacuum typically comes down to its suction ability. Greater suction power generally enables the vacuum to clean much better, particularly in homes with family pets or heavy foot traffic.
- Navigation Technology: Efficient navigation systems boost a robot vacuum's capability to clean thoroughly and effectively. Features like mapping and obstacle detection are paramount.
- Battery Life: A longer battery life suggests more extensive cleaning sessions without disruptions. It's crucial for homes with larger areas.
- Smart Features: Integration with smart home systems, usage of mobile apps, and voice control capabilities can significantly enhance the user experience.
- Maintenance Requirements: Ease of maintenance, such as clearing dust bins and cleaning brushes, can influence the benefit of a robot vacuum.
- Noise Levels: Some vacuums run more quietly than others, making them suitable for homes with children or family pets.
Table 1: Key Features of Top Robot Vacuums
Brand/ Model | Suction Power (Pa) | Navigation Technology | Battery Life (min) | Smart Features | Sound Level (dB) |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
iRobot Roomba s9+ | 2200 | Advanced Mapping | 120 | Alexa, Google Assistant | 65 |
Roborock S7 | 2500 | Lidar Navigation | 180 | App Control | 67 |
Ecovacs Deebot Ozmo T8 AIVI | 3000 | Smart Navigation | 180 | AI Recognition | 65 |
Neato Botvac D7 | 2000 | Laser Navigation | 120 | Smartphone Control | 67 |
Shark IQ Robot | 1800 | Smart Mapping | 90 | Voice Control | 68 |
Top Picks for Best Robot Vacuums
Choosing the ideal robot vacuum can be challenging due to the myriad of options. Here's a more detailed look at a few of the best robot vacuums currently readily available:
iRobot Roomba s9+
- Overview: The iRobot Roomba s9+ is created for superior cleaning efficiency, including strong suction power and advanced mapping capabilities. It's especially efficient for animal owners due to its high-efficiency filter that records allergens.
- Pros:
- Top-tier cleaning efficiency.
- Smart mapping for tailored cleaning.
- Self-emptying dustbin function.
- Cons: Higher price point compared to rivals.
Roborock S7
- Introduction: The Roborock S7 provides a well balanced mix of vacuuming and mopping features. Its innovative sonic mopping innovation permits for efficient cleaning, making it a flexible option.
- Pros:
- Excellent suction and mopping efficiency.
- Efficient navigation.
- Long battery life.
- Cons: It can be a bit louder than anticipated.
Ecovacs Deebot Ozmo T8 AIVI
- Introduction: This robot vacuum comes with innovative artificial intelligence capabilities. The Deebot Ozmo T8 AIVI can recognize and avoid common barriers.
- Pros:
- Self-emptying feature.
- Strong suction and mopping functionality.
- AI-enabled navigation system.
- Cons: The app can be complicated for some users.
Neato Botvac D7
- Introduction: With its distinct D-shape design, the Neato Botvac D7 can reach corners and edges successfully. Its laser navigation enables for accurate room mapping.
- Pros:
- Outstanding edge cleaning capabilities.
- Adjustable cleaning zones.
- Cons: The style may not suit all aesthetic choices.
Shark IQ Robot
- Introduction: The Shark IQ Robot is known for its self-cleaning brush roll, making it ideal for family pet hair. It provides an amazing balance between performance and cost.
- Pros:
- Self-emptying function.
- Economical.
- Good suction power and navigation.
- Cons: Limited battery life for larger areas.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. How do I preserve my robot vacuum?
- Routine upkeep includes emptying the dust bin, cleaning the brushes, and inspecting sensing units for dust accumulation. Cleaning the filters as advised by the manufacturer is also vital.
2. Can robot vacuums work on carpets?
- Yes, many modern-day robot vacuums are designed to manage various surfaces, consisting of carpets. Vacuum designs differ in their efficiency, so consider one with adjustable suction power for carpets.
3. Are robot vacuums worth the financial investment?
- For numerous, the benefit and time conserved exceed the preliminary expense. They can assist preserve a cleaner home with less handbook effort.
4. Do robot vacuums require Wi-Fi?
- While numerous robot vacuums provide smart features through mobile apps that require Wi-Fi, basic cleaning functions can typically be used without a web connection.
